Features at a Glance

Key components: Main unit, Remote Control, HDMI cable, AV cable, Power adapter, User manual.

FeatureDescription
HDMI OutputFor high-quality digital video and audio connection
Component Video OutputFor progressive scan video connection
Composite AV OutputStandard video and audio connection
Digital Audio OutputCoaxial and optical outputs for surround sound
USB PortFor playing media files from USB storage devices
Multi-format PlaybackSupports DVD, CD, MP3, JPEG, DivX formats
Progressive ScanProvides smoother, higher quality video
Dolby Digital/DTSSurround sound compatibility
Zoom FunctionMagnifies specific areas of the picture
Parental ControlRestricts playback of certain content

Installation

Unpack and inspect all contents. Place on stable, level surface.

  1. Connect to TV: Use HDMI cable for best quality, or component/composite cables.
  2. Connect to audio system: Use digital audio output to home theater receiver.
  3. Connect power: Plug power adapter into wall outlet and unit.
  4. Insert batteries: Install batteries in remote control.

WARNING! Ensure proper ventilation around unit. Do not place in enclosed spaces.

First-Time Setup

Power on DVD player and TV; follow on-screen prompts.

  1. Select language: Choose preferred menu language (default: ENGLISH).
  2. Set TV aspect ratio: Choose 4:3 or 16:9 based on your TV.
  3. Configure audio output: Select appropriate audio format for your system.
  4. Set parental controls: Establish password if desired (default: 0000).

CAUTION! Keep unit away from heat sources and direct sunlight.

Controls and Settings

Front Panel: POWER, OPEN/CLOSE, PLAY, STOP, USB port, Display window.

Remote: POWER, Numeric buttons, OPEN/CLOSE, PLAY, PAUSE, STOP, MENU, NAVIGATION arrows, OK, RETURN, AUDIO, SUBTITLE, ZOOM, REPEAT.

Settings Menu: Video (Resolution, TV Type, Screen Saver), Audio (Digital Output, Dynamic Range), Language (Menu, Audio, Subtitle), Parental (Rating, Password), System (Standby, Default).

Connecting Devices

HDMI: Single cable for video and audio. Component: YPbPr cables for progressive video. Audio: Digital coaxial/optical to receiver.

  1. Turn off all devices before connecting cables.
  2. Match cable colors to corresponding ports.
  3. Select correct input source on TV/receiver.
  4. Power on devices in sequence: TV, audio system, then DVD player.

Tip: Use high-quality cables for best performance.

Playing Media

Supports various disc formats and USB media.

  1. Insert disc: Press OPEN/CLOSE, place disc label-side up, close tray.
  2. Navigation: Use arrow keys to select from menu, press PLAY or OK.
  3. Playback controls: PAUSE, STOP, SKIP forward/backward, SCAN.
  4. Audio options: Press AUDIO to select different audio tracks/languages.
  5. Subtitle options: Press SUBTITLE to enable/select subtitles.
  6. Zoom: Press ZOOM to magnify (2x, 4x, 8x).
  7. Repeat: Press REPEAT for chapter/title/all repeat modes.
  8. Bookmark: Press MARK to save position for later resumption.

WARNING! Do not move player during disc playback. Handle discs by edges only.

USB Playback

Connect USB device to front panel port.

  1. Insert USB drive: System automatically detects compatible files.
  2. Navigate files: Use arrow keys to browse folders and select files.
  3. Supported formats: MP3, WMA, JPEG, DivX, Xvid, MPEG-4.
  4. Play modes: Normal, Repeat One, Repeat All, Shuffle.
  5. Slide show: For JPEG files with background music option.

Note: USB device must be formatted as FAT32. Maximum capacity: 32GB.

Care & Cleaning

Unplug from power before cleaning. Use soft, dry cloth for exterior. For lens cleaning, use approved CD/DVD lens cleaner only.

CAUTION! Never use abrasive cleaners, solvents, or compressed air. Avoid liquid contact with unit.

Troubleshooting

SymptomPossible CauseCorrective Action
No powerPower connectionCheck power cord connection; ensure outlet is working.
No pictureVideo connection/TV inputVerify cables are secure; select correct input on TV.
No soundAudio settings/connectionsCheck audio cables; verify TV/receiver input selection; check mute.
Disc not recognizedDisc format/damageEnsure disc is compatible format; check for scratches; clean disc.
Remote not workingBatteries/obstructionReplace batteries; ensure clear path to IR sensor; check distance.
USB not detectedFormat/compatibilityReformat as FAT32; check file compatibility; try different USB device.
Playback freezingDisc damage/dirty lensClean disc; use lens cleaner; try different disc.

Reset: Unplug for 30 seconds, then reconnect. Or use Factory Reset in System menu.
